6:Identify Profitable Locations:
Finding the right locations to install your ATM machines is critical to maximizing profitability and attracting customers.
Look for crowded places like shopping malls, convenience stores, gas stations, and placesAnother retail outlet where people often need to get cash.
Negotiate favorable terms with landlords or businesses to protect prime locations for your ATM machines and drive customer traffic to your business.
7:competitive Pricing:
Determine competitive pricing strategies for your ATM services to attract customers and differentiate your business from competitors.
Consider factors such as transaction fees, surcharges, and service fees when setting the price of your ATM machines.
balance between generating revenue and providing value to customers to build a loyal customer base and drivebusiness growth.
